Oil falls on growing US shale production

Oil production forecast to rise to record 7.71 million bpd in November, EIA says

Oil price: Brent crude was down 50 cents a barrel at $80.28 by 1320 GMT
Oil price: Brent crude was down 50 cents a barrel at $80.28 by 1320 GMT
Published 16 October 2018, 15:51Updated 16 October 2018, 15:51